Fraudster surrenders after four years on the run in Ndwedwe

A female fraudster on the run from Law Enforcement for the past four years surrendered herself to Police.

A criminal case was registered at the Maloti SAPS in Matatiele – Eastern Cape against 32-year-old Busisiwe Sunshine Ngcobo in August 2020 after she allegedly defrauded the complainant for R250 000. Ngcobo advertised a mini bus online but failed to deliver the vehicle after the money was transferred into her account. She has since been on the run.

Yesterday (Thursday), Detectives from the SAPS Commercial Crime Unit in Matatiele – Eastern Cape arrived at Reaction Unit South Africa (RUSA) HQ requesting assistance to apprehend the fraudster who was believed to be hiding out in Ndwedwe – KZN. A Warrant for her arrest was issued on 19/06/2024.

Information provided by the Investigation Officers was circulated on this Facebook page. Reaction Officers received multiple tip offs from the public and were in the process of proceeding to the suspect’s home Sokombo in Ndwedwe –
KZN but she surrendered herself to the Verulam SAPS prior to their arrival.

The Investigating Officers were preparing to return to the Eastern Cape when they were informed of the surrender. They proceeded to the Verulam SAPS and uplifted Ngcobo. She is currently being transported back to Matatiele – Eastern Cape.

Ngcobo is expected to appear in the Matatiele Magistrates Court on Monday.
